苹果手机录屏无法捕获主屏幕小组件动画,需用快捷指令触发、辅助触控模拟点击、Siri同步启动、Mac投屏或调整系统设置五种方法绕过限制。

如果您希望在苹果手机上录制小组件(如实时活动、动态壁纸、快捷指令小组件)的动画效果,需注意系统对小组件区域的录屏存在限制——默认控制中心录屏无法捕获主屏幕小组件的交互动画,必须采用特定路径绕过该限制。以下是解决此问题的步骤:
一、使用快捷指令+控制中心组合触发录屏
该方法通过预设快捷指令强制启动录屏,并在启动瞬间快速返回主屏幕,确保小组件动画处于活跃状态并被完整捕获。适用于iOS 16及以上版本,可规避小组件区域被系统屏蔽的问题。
1、打开「快捷指令」App,点击右上角「+」新建指令。
2、点击「添加操作」,搜索并选择「录制屏幕」操作。
3、点击右上角「下一步」,将指令命名为“小组件动画录屏”。
4、点击「完成」保存指令。
5、从屏幕右上角下滑调出控制中心,长按「屏幕录制」按钮,开启麦克风(如需配音),点击「开始录制」。
6、立即点击Home键或手势返回主屏幕,等待小组件动画自然运行(如天气刷新、日历倒计时、快捷指令实时更新)。
7、保持屏幕常亮,待动画循环播放至少两轮后,点击顶部红色状态栏并选择「停止」。
二、启用辅助触控模拟点击以激活小组件交互
部分小组件(如“绘蛙-多图成片”、“轻点背面”绑定指令)需用户触发才播放动画。本方法利用辅助触控生成精确点击坐标,确保动画在录屏过程中被真实唤起,避免静止画面被误录。
1、进入「设置」→「辅助功能」→「触控」→「辅助触控」,开启开关。
2、点击「自定顶层菜单」,添加「设备」→「更多」→「轻点两下」动作(若已用于其他功能,请先解除绑定)。
3、返回主屏幕,长按任意空白处进入编辑模式,确认目标小组件已添加且处于可交互状态。
4、启动控制中心录屏(长按录屏按钮并开启麦克风)。
5、倒计时结束前1秒,用辅助触控圆球点击「设备」→「更多」→「轻点两下」,模拟真实手指双击背部动作,触发小组件响应动画。
6、持续观察小组件区域,确保动画帧率稳定,无卡顿或黑屏。
三、通过Siri语音指令同步启动录屏与小组件刷新
该方法利用Siri在后台唤醒系统服务的能力,在不中断主屏幕显示的前提下,同步触发录屏与小组件数据拉取,保障动画起始帧完整记录。适用于支持实时网络更新的小组件(如股票、新闻、运动数据)。
1、在「快捷指令」App中,长按已创建的“小组件动画录屏”指令,点击「编辑」。
2、点击右上角「…」→「添加到Siri」,输入语音短语,例如“开始录小组件动画”。
3、进入「设置」→「Siri与听写」,确认「听懂“嘿 Siri”」和「按下侧边按钮使用Siri」均已开启。
4、确保iPhone连接Wi-Fi且目标小组件后台刷新权限已开启(「设置」→「通用」→「后台App刷新」→ 开启对应App)。
5、说出设定的Siri短语,听到提示音后立即返回主屏幕,观察小组件是否开始加载新数据并播放过渡动画。
6、录制满所需时长后,点击红色状态栏停止。
四、使用第三方录屏工具捕获主屏幕全帧
当系统原生录屏持续丢失小组件区域画面时,该方案借助Mac端QuickTime Player配合USB有线投屏,实现主屏幕1:1镜像录制,完全绕过iOS对小组件区域的渲染限制,确保动画逐帧无损输出。
1、准备一台运行macOS 13或更高版本的Mac,确保已安装最新版iTunes或Apple Configurator 2。
2、使用原装Lightning或USB-C数据线将iPhone连接Mac,信任此电脑。
3、在Mac上打开QuickTime Player,点击「文件」→「新建影片录制」。
4、点击录制窗口右下角箭头,选择您的iPhone为摄像机与麦克风源。
5、在iPhone上进入主屏幕,确保目标小组件可见且处于活跃状态(如正在播放实时倒计时)。
6、点击QuickTime录制按钮,开始捕获镜像画面;此时所有小组件动画均以原始帧率呈现。
7、录制完成后点击停止,视频直接保存至Mac,无需导入照片App。
五、调整系统设置提升小组件动画录制稳定性
部分iOS版本存在小组件动画在录屏时降帧或暂停的问题,本方法通过关闭干扰性系统动画与后台服务,确保GPU资源集中分配给主屏幕渲染,从而维持小组件动画流畅性。
1、进入「设置」→「辅助功能」→「动态效果」,关闭「减弱动态效果」以外的所有选项(保留此项可防止动画异常加速)。
2、进入「设置」→「通用」→「传输或还原iPhone」→「还原」→「还原所有设置」(注意:此操作不删除数据,仅重置系统动画与网络参数)。
3、重启iPhone后,进入「设置」→「隐私与安全性」→「定位服务」→「系统服务」,关闭「重要地点」与「基于位置的Apple广告」。
4、再次打开「设置」→「照片」→ 关闭「iCloud照片」同步(避免后台上传占用带宽影响小组件数据刷新)。
5、返回主屏幕,手动下拉刷新小组件,确认其动画响应正常后再启动录屏流程。











